ive just painted my vtr rims white an ive started to do the interior plastics

but i dont have a clue how to take the surrounding of the clocks off

and how to take the thing that the clocks sit in as i would like to paint it blue and white

The clock surround has 2 screws in the top of it that go up into the dash. Take these out and the rest unclips. However, you may need to take the steering wheel off, or drop the steering column down to get the surround out past the wheel.

Clocks are held in with 4 torx screws iirc, which will be visible once you remove the surround. Plasic cover then unclips from the dial binicle.
